Digital Processes for Education and Management of Construction

In Finland and Estonia the construction sector is changing constantly, especially when it comes to conditions, organizations and teams. People within the building sector are moving across the borders which leads to challenges in communication and fluent interaction. In the construction site environment planners, management and workers have too little time to deliver and acquire enough information on each stage of the workflow. The processes have become more complicated and the tasks more expertised. Due to this the changes in the methods of work require more education.

The DigiEduEt project raises the level of local building know-how of the good quality building standards followed in the Central Baltic Programme Area. It resources the accomplishment of local quality standards and researches the new efficient education models which are more target and sector oriented and suitable for present forms of industrial processes. In addition, the project makes in co-creation a translation and localization of materials of building and construction instruction data files into Estonian language and tests the quality of created content in the research pilot groups.

This way project creates resources for safety and quality standards as good tools for Estonian construction site’s process management, planning and education. Furthermore, the project makes a digital production, installation and web-based publication system for multilingual construction data materials.
